site stats

Ms sql sharding

Web12 iun. 2024 · NoSQL is a non-relational database, meaning it allows different structures than a SQL database (not rows and columns) and more flexibility to use a format that best fits the data. The term “NoSQL” was not coined until the early 2000s. It doesn’t mean the systems don’t use SQL, as NoSQL databases do sometimes support some SQL … Web4 aug. 2024 · Wikipedia defines multi-tenancy as " a software architecture in which a single instance of software runs on a server and serves multiple tenants." It means having a number of tenants (organizations, typically) all accessing a shared instance of the software, where they have the appearance that they are the only ones using it.

dotnetcore/sharding-core - Github

Web7 feb. 2024 · Sharding is a database architecture pattern related to horizontal partitioning — the practice of separating one table’s rows into multiple different tables, known as partitions. Each partition has the … Web17 ian. 2016 · For example, if you are sharding by user_id, any query which spans multiple users will need to be sent to all servers (or a subset of servers) and the results must be … scrum advantages over waterfall https://oliviazarapr.com

Himanshu Patel - Database Developer Administrator - LinkedIn

WebMySQL Database Sharding and Partitioning are two database scaling techniques that aim to improve the database’s performance and scalability. Sharding involves splitting a … Web27 ian. 2024 · This article looks at four data sharding strategies for distributed SQL including algorithmic, range, linear, and consistent hash. Join the DZone community and get the full member experience. A ... WebLeaseQuery's headquarters is located in Atlanta, GA, but this role can sit 100% remote. Ensure scalable, reliable, and performant AWS PostGres databases and environments. Interfacing daily with ... scrum adventures retrospectives

Sharding - Doctrine Database Abstraction Layer (DBAL)

Category:SQL vs. NoSQL Databases: What

Tags:Ms sql sharding

Ms sql sharding

Sharding - Doctrine Database Abstraction Layer (DBAL)

WebModular sharding. 모듈러샤딩은 PK를 모듈러 연산한 결과로 DB를 특정하는 방식입니다. 간략한 장단점은 아래와 같습니다. 장점 : 레인지샤딩에 비해 데이터가 균일하게 분산됩니다. 단점 : DB를 추가 증설하는 과정에서 이미 적재된 데이터의 재정렬이 필요합니다 ... Web12 ian. 2024 · Adopting a sharding architecture on a pre-existing distributed database system, might cause SQL compatibility issues. Previously functioning SQLs might not run successfully in the newly created ...

Ms sql sharding

Did you know?

Web23 sept. 2024 · Sharding at the core is splitting your data up to where it resides in smaller chunks, spread across distinct separate buckets. A bucket could be a table, a postgres schema, or a different physical database. Then as you need to continue scaling you’re able to move your shards to new physical nodes thus improving performance. WebExpertise in: How to save Server infrastructure cost, How to optimize servers and databases, How to stream line build promotion in different environment. More than 20 Year Total IT experience &10 year MSSQL Database Development, SSRS, SSIS and SSAS Query optimization and Performance Tuning Distributed Database on Multiple SQL …

Web3 feb. 2024 · FOCUS ON: Blog, Azure. Scaling out (or sharding) by adding more databases usually requires careful planning and provisioning to ensure even distribution of data. It also adds more administrative overhead, and increases the number of points of failure. In this respect, Azure SQL databases are the perfect candidates for sharding because they can ...

Weba) Replication takes the same data and copies it over multiple nodes. Sharding puts different data on different nodes. b) Sharding is particularly valuable for performance because it can improve both read and write performance. Using replication, particularly with caching, can greatly improve read performance but does little for applications ... Web12 iul. 2024 · YugaByte DB is an auto-sharded, ultra-resilient, high-performance, geo-distributed SQL database built with inspiration from Google Spanner. It currently supports hash-based sharding by default.

Web前面几个都是针对MySQL 的 Sharding 方案,PL/Proxy 则是针对 PostgreSQL 的,设计思想类似 Teradata 的 Hash 机制,数据存储对客户端是透明的,客户请求发送到 PL/Proxy …

WebMicrosoft scrum agile methodenWeb6 iun. 2024 · В языке запросов Azure SQL реализовано подмножество функций T-SQL. Экземпляры сервисов Azure SQL, являющиеся прямыми аналогами баз данных MS-SQL, логически группируются в «серверы» Azure SQL Server. scrum agile methodWebI'm an enthusiastic and optimistic person eager to learn new things and to consolidate the skills that I already have. I'm interested in Java, C#, Clojure, Scala, Kotlin, Javascript. I love to play around with some DevOps cool stuff such as Docker, Kubernetes, Ansible, Teamcity or Jenkins etc. I also love enterprise patterns, … pcp in company nameWeb18 nov. 2024 · 使用shardingsphere实现SQL server数据库分表. 项目中数据量比较大,单表千万级别的,需要实现分表,于是在网上搜索这方面的开源框架,最常见的就是 mycat ,sharding-sphere,最终我选择后者,用它来做分库分表比较容易上手。. sharding-jdbc 定位为轻量级Java框架,在Java的JDBC层 ... scrum agile methodeWebDatabase sharding is a type of horizontal partitioning that splits large databases into smaller components, which are faster and easier to manage. A shard is an individual partition … pcp increase strengthWebJeremiah talks about Sharding in SQL Server; If you’re using availability groups, they’re grounded in failover clusters. Get familiar with: ... Scaling Full Text Search in an OLTP Environment – we ran into a problem with SQL 2008’s new FTS and got help from Microsoft. High Scalability Profile of StackOverflow – talks about the ... scrum agile software developmentWebThis data will then be replicated down to each shard allowing each shard to read this data and inner join to this data in t-sql procs. 2) design 2 - Give each shard its own copy of all common/universal data. Let each shard write locally to these tables and utilize sql merge replication to update/sync this data on all other shards. scrum agile planning